ADI Hedge Fund Activity: Q3 2025 in Review

1,839 of the 7,619 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Analog Devices (ADI) for Q3 2025, worth a combined $105B — down 2.9% from $108B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 181 funds opened new ADI positions and 95 closed out — a net gain of 86 holders — while 741 added to existing stakes and 618 trimmed.

The largest buyer was BlackRock, adding an estimated $477M. The largest seller was JP Morgan Chase, cutting an estimated $998M.
